Q: Is 15,182,194 a Prime Number?
A: No, 15,182,194 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 15182194 can be evenly divided by 1 2 83 166 91,459 182,918 7,591,097 and 15,182,194, with no remainder.
Since 15,182,194 cannot be divided by just 1 and 15,182,194, it is not a prime number.
